Comparenow.com was launched in March of 2013 to simplify auto insurance shopping for US consumers. The site is the first in the US to allow consumers to enter their information once and immediately receive real, unbiased and accurate quotes from multiple licensed auto insurance companies.
The quotes are a true "apples to apples" comparison because the insurance companies available through comparenow.com consider the exact same driver and vehicle information in order to quote a price. Consumers can review the provided quotes, and then one click will allow them to purchase that selected policy directly from their chosen insurer on the web, over the phone, or with a local agent.
